Oil: The Market Trades Risk, Not Balance
The main driver of the oil market is the geopolitical risk premium. The Strait of Hormuz remains a critical route for global oil and gas trade, with a substantial portion of Middle Eastern exports traditionally passing through. Any reduction in tanker traffic is immediately reflected in Brent, WTI, and the Middle Eastern grades of Oman, Dubai, and Murban.
For investors, this means that the baseline scenario for the oil market has shifted back from a calm discussion of surplus to an assessment of the physical availability of crude. In the coming days, the market will focus not only on prices but also on the following indicators:
- the dynamics of tanker movement through the Strait of Hormuz;
- the spread between near and distant Brent contracts;
- oil inventories in the U.S. and OECD countries;
- refinery processing levels;
- margins on diesel, gasoline, and aviation fuel.
A key market signal is Brent's transition into pronounced backwardation, where near-term contracts are priced higher than future ones. This indicates that market participants are willing to pay a premium for immediate oil supply. For oil companies, this structure supports cash flows, but it raises procurement costs for raw material consumers and refineries.
Oil Products and Refineries: Diesel Becomes a Separate Center of Tension
The oil products market appears tougher than the crude oil market. Diesel futures are increasing faster than oil, and crack spreads—the refining margin—remain high. This is a positive factor for refineries in terms of profitability, but for industrial consumers, logistics companies, the agricultural sector, and fuel operators, it signifies rising costs.
The situation is exacerbated by several factors:
- reduced export availability of certain diesel batches due to attacks on refining infrastructure;
- low commercial fuel stocks in certain regions;
- the summer season sees high demand for gasoline, aviation fuel, and diesel;
- traders are shifting to more reliable supply routes;
- increased insurance and freight costs for vessels in high-risk areas.
For fuel companies and oil traders, the environment may lead to a rethinking of procurement strategies. The focus will be on contracts with guaranteed logistics, supplier diversification, and inventory management. Refineries with access to a stable feedstock base and export channels will have the advantage.
Gas and LNG: Asia, Europe, and the Middle East Compete for Flexible Volumes
The gas market remains just as crucial as oil. LNG has become the main instrument of global energy security in 2026: Europe continues to rebuild stocks ahead of the winter season, Asia is competing for flexible cargoes, while the Middle East remains a key supplier to the global market.
For Europe, the main question is the speed of filling underground storage facilities. After several years of adjusting the gas balance, the region is becoming increasingly dependent on LNG, pipeline supplies from Norway and North Africa, and its ability to purchase cargoes on the global market without significant price premiums. For Asia, weather, industrial demand, and competition between Japan, South Korea, China, India, and Southeast Asian countries are critical.
U.S. LNG remains one of the key balancing sources. Export forecasts for U.S. LNG in 2026 project an increase to about 17 billion cubic feet per day, enhancing the role of the U.S. as a global gas supplier. However, cargo destinations will depend on the price spread between Europe and Asia.
Electricity: The Main New Shortage is Not Oil, but Capacity
The global energy landscape is rapidly shifting from the question of “where to source fuel” to “where to find sustainable electricity.” The growth of data centers, artificial intelligence, industrial electrification, air conditioning, and charging infrastructure is creating new burdens on energy systems.
The U.S. is expected to set further consumption records for electricity in 2026–2027. Key drivers include data centers, industry, electric vehicles, heat pumps, and summer cooling peaks. For energy companies, this opens a new investment cycle: gas-fired power plants, solar generation, energy storage, grid modernization, and direct contracts with large consumers are becoming strategic assets.
For investors in the energy sector, this signifies the emergence of a new class of infrastructure projects: electricity is evolving from a mere utility into a fundamental platform for the digital economy.
Renewable Energy: Growth Continues, but Politics and Grids Become Constraints
Renewable energy maintains structural growth. Solar power, wind generation, and battery systems remain key investment areas. In Europe, the share of renewables in several energy systems has reached record levels, with Germany obtaining more than half of its electricity consumption from renewable sources in the first half of 2026.
However, the renewable energy sector is entering a more complex phase. While previously the main concern was the cost of solar panels and wind turbines, key constraints now include:
- grid capacity;
- speed of new project connections;
- cost of energy storage;
- regulatory stability;
- availability of long-term power purchase agreements.
For investors, it is not just about the growth of installed renewable capacity but also the quality of business models: projects with storage solutions, corporate PPAs, access to grids, and clear regulatory frameworks will be valued higher than isolated solar or wind farms lacking flexibility.
Coal: Global Decline is Slow, Regional Differences Persist
Coal remains an essential component of global energy, especially in Asia. Despite a long-term trend towards energy transition, coal-fired generation still serves as a backup source of power during periods of high demand, low renewable output, or expensive gas.
China and India remain the primary centers of global coal demand, although the growth of renewables gradually limits the increase in coal generation. In the U.S. and some Asian countries, coal may temporarily receive support amid rising gas prices or when there is insufficient grid flexibility. For investors, this creates a dual picture: while long-term prospects for coal are pressured by climate policies, it still plays a crucial role for energy security in the short term.
